Price anchoring mechanism, within cryptocurrency derivatives, establishes a reference point influencing perceived value and subsequent trading decisions. This operates by presenting an initial price, often a prior high or low, which subconsciously affects evaluations of current market prices, impacting option pricing and trade execution. Its effectiveness stems from cognitive biases, where traders assess subsequent prices relative to this initial anchor, potentially leading to deviations from rational valuation models. Consequently, understanding its influence is crucial for managing risk and identifying potential arbitrage opportunities in volatile crypto markets.
